Product information "NF-qB SEAP Reporter Lentivirus"
The NF-?B SEAP Reporter Lentivirus are replication incompetent, HIV-based, VSV-G pseudotyped lentiviral particles that are ready to transduce almost all types of mammalian cells, including primary and nondividing cells. The particles contain a SEAP (Secreted Embryonic Alkaline Phosphatase) reporter driven by the NF-?B (nuclear factor kappa-light-chain-enhancer of activated B cells) response element located upstream of the minimal TATA promoter. These lentiviruses also transduce a puromycin selection marker (Figure 1). After transduction, activation of the NF-?B signaling pathway in the target cells can be monitored by measuring SEAP activity. Figure 1. Schematic of the lenti-vector used to generate the NF-?B SEAP Reporter Lentivirus. The role of NF-kappaB (nuclear factor kappa-light chain enhancer of activated B cells) is well-characterized in canonical (classical) and noncanonical (alternative) signaling pathways of inflammation. Two major forms of innate immune sensors are Toll-like receptors (TLR) and NOD/CATERPILLER proteins. Mutations in NOD2 (nucleotide-binding oligomerization domain-containing protein 2) have been linked to chronic autoinflammatory and autoimmune diseases, such as Crohn's disease and Blaus syndrome. Studying the canonical and noncanonical NF-kappaB pathways and the influence of TLR pathways and NOD2 mutations can further our understanding of autoimmune regulation. The use of reporter systems allows for easy assay read outs. SEAP (Secreted Embryonic Alkaline Phosphatase) is a reporter protein that has been extensively used to assess the activity of transcription factors of interest. Since SEAP is secreted, cell lysis is not required to measure reporter activity, simplifying the assay.
